I am surprised this video didnt mention Ronzoni, San Giorgio, and some other pasta brands, Hershey owned Ronzoni from 1990-1999, meaning at the time of the video, it was Hershey owned. San Giorgio was from 1966-1999. In 1999 Hershey spun off all their pasta brands to get cash to expand in chocolate, but still owned a 30% stake in the new company until 2021 when that was fully sold to another company, fully divesting Hershey's from Pasta

Hershey has not only Hershey Foods, but they have two daughter companies. Well, one company and a non profit charity school. They have Hershey Entertainment and Resorts Company, and the Milton Hershey School. I work for HERCo and they have a hand in all of the town of Hershey, Pa. They have an amusement park, around 5 restaurants, 2 hotels, a giant candy store, Chocolate World, a zoo, a garden, a golf course, 2 ice rinks, a stadium, an ice hockey team, a campground, a theatre, and have a hand in our Chipotle, Rite Aid, Duck Donuts, and Tanger Outlets. They are huge and have the backing of Hershey Foods. Milton Hershey School was started by Milton and Catherine Hershey because they couldn't have children. So they started and orphanage for boys. Now it is a boarding school for kids who's parents make less than $15,000 a year. My grandfather went there and it is incredible. They are so rich because not only did Milton leave his fortune to the school when he and his wife died, but a penny from every Hershey bar goes to the school! That's a crap ton of money. Last year, they built and tore down an auditorium so they could stay a non profit. So yah, Hershey is not just Hershey Foods. Just a side note, Mark Hershey Farms, the ones who make the ice cream, while being in Palmyra, a neighboring town, are not Hershey foods! They are different, Hershey doesn't make ice cream that isn't available outside HERCo property.

They do not. Hersheypark used to be owned by Hershey Chocolate Corporation until 1927. That year, the non-food production businesses were separated into its own company (this included the amusement park, the electric company, the water company, the laundry, a nursery, and other businesses), called Hershey Estates. Today, that company is called Hershey Entertainment & Resorts Company.

I worked for the company (Hershey Entertainment & Resorts Company) between 2001 and 2015. We didn't make chocolate. The Hershey Company is owned by the Hershey Trust Company, which this video was not about. The Hershey Trust Company owns The Hershey Company via majority ownership of the public stock. The Hershey Trust Company owns Hershey Entertainment & Resorts Company through sole private ownership. These two companies are separate. The businesses were deliberately divided, so, in the event the chocolate company ever failed, it wouldn't take the town of Hershey with it. So no, The Hershey Company does not own Hersheypark, the Hershey Trust Company does.
